A few days ago I was doing some stuff on my computer and I accidentally screwed up some files on my OS drive. I tried to restore to a previous date but its says not enough disk space. Then it starts popping up and telling me my copy of Windows 7 is not genuine. I popped in my Windows 7 Installation Disc 64 bit retail version that I installed on this computer when I built it last year and went through the upgrade/repair option from the disc. After a few hours it came up with this error saying the upgrade didn't work. So I decide to restore my system again after clearing out some space on my OS drive and it works this time. A few days go bye normally and I think the problem is gone and then the window pops up again.

What can I do? The online solutions seem to assume you never have the original OS install disc which I have but I am not sure how I use this to verify my OS.
